JUSTICE SUDHIR SINGH ORAL ORDER 13-10-2015 Heard learned counsel for the petitioner and the State. The petitioner seeks bail in a case instituted under Section 394 of the Indian Penal Code.
Allegation against the petitioner is that he along with other accused persons snatched Rs, 7,600/-, A.T.M cards, mobile and motorcycle from the informant.
It has been submitted on behalf of the petitioner that he is in custody since 16.5.2015. Chargesheet has been submitted in the case. There is no allegation of tampering of evidence against the petitioner. Petitioner is not named in the F.I.R. He has not been put on T.I.P. It is further submitted that petitioner may be released after completion of nine months in custody from 16.5.2015. On behalf of the State, it is submitted that the petitioner is not named in the F.I.R. but A.T.M. cards of the informant is said to have been recovered from the possession of this petitioner. Considering the aforesaid facts and circumstances, let the above named petitioner be released on bail after completion of
